Output e42da905094566ddf644ef00a4524e7dd2f402dbf6cb3bda9437c6fa1a520ab1:1

value
58194
script pubkey
OP_0 OP_PUSHBYTES_20 ba71faf4718e1aa670f6e0311741941251530f43
address
bc1qhfcl4ar33cd2vu8kuqc3wsv5zfg4xr6rqreywr
transaction
e42da905094566ddf644ef00a4524e7dd2f402dbf6cb3bda9437c6fa1a520ab1
confirmations
16026
spent
true